Why are sales slow in January?

There are a few potential reasons why sales may be slower in January. The post-holiday blues can lead to a decrease in consumer confidence and spending. Additionally, the winter weather may also play a role in slowing down sales, as people may be less likely to shop online or go out to physical stores. Finally, some people may still be recovering from holiday spending and may be more cautious with their purchases.

How do you increase website sales?

There are many strategies that businesses can use to increase website sales, including:

  • Improving the user experience on the website
  • Offering promotions or discounts
  • Utilizing email marketing to stay in touch with customers
  • Implementing an effective social media strategy
  • Investing in search engine optimization (SEO) to improve the website's visibility in search results
  • Running retargeting ads to bring people back to the website who have previously visited

What is peak season in eCommerce?

Peak season in eCommerce refers to the busiest shopping periods of the year, which can vary depending on the products or services being sold. For many businesses, peak season falls around the holiday shopping period in November and December. However, other businesses may experience peak sales at different times of the year, such as during back-to-school season or on major shopping holidays like Black Friday.

What are consumers buying in January?

Consumers may be interested in a wide range of products in January. Some people may be looking for post-holiday sales or discounts on winter clothing and accessories, while others may be making purchases in anticipation of the upcoming Valentine's Day holiday. It is important for businesses to stay up to date on consumer trends and adjust their product offerings and marketing strategies accordingly.
